Comparison of Discrete Choice Models and Artificial Neural Networks in Presence of Missing Variables

11/06/2018
by   Johan Barthélemy, et al.
0

Classification, the process of assigning a label (or class) to an observation given its features, is a common task in many applications. Nonetheless in most real-life applications, the labels can not be fully explained by the observed features. Indeed there can be many factors hidden to the modellers. The unexplained variation is then treated as some random noise which is handled differently depending on the method retained by the practitioner. This work focuses on two simple and widely used supervised classification algorithms: discrete choice models and artificial neural networks in the context of binary classification. Through various numerical experiments involving continuous or discrete explanatory features, we present a comparison of the retained methods' performance in presence of missing variables. The impact of the distribution of the two classes in the training data is also investigated. The outcomes of those experiments highlight the fact that artificial neural networks outperforms the discrete choice models, except when the distribution of the classes in the training data is highly unbalanced. Finally, this work provides some guidelines for choosing the right classifier with respect to the training data.

READ FULL TEXT

page 11

page 14

research
09/25/2021

Predicting Hidden Links and Missing Nodes in Scale-Free Networks with Artificial Neural Networks

There are many networks in real life which exist as form of Scale-free n...
research
04/05/2017

The Relative Performance of Ensemble Methods with Deep Convolutional Neural Networks for Image Classification

Artificial neural networks have been successfully applied to a variety o...
research
11/11/2022

Artificial neural networks for predicting the viscosity of lead-containing glasses

The viscosity of lead-containing glasses is of fundamental importance fo...
research
11/06/2019

Correlated Feature Selection for Tweet Spam Classification using Artificial Neural Networks

Identification of spam messages is a very challenging task for social ne...
research
12/20/2017

Combining Static and Dynamic Features for Multivariate Sequence Classification

Model precision in a classification task is highly dependent on the feat...
research
06/14/2016

Neural Networks and Continuous Time

The fields of neural computation and artificial neural networks have dev...
research
09/15/2018

Neural Networks and Quantifier Conservativity: Does Data Distribution Affect Learnability?

All known natural language determiners are conservative. Psycholinguisti...

Please sign up or login with your details

Forgot password? Click here to reset